The anecdotal evidence that cannabidiol (CBD) can be an effective supplement for humans has led many dog owners to ask about using CBD oil for their dog. After all, dogs can suffer from many of the same ailments as humans, including pain, anxiety, arthritis, seizures, joint problems and skin issues.

As with all CBD products, it's important to buy CBD oils for dogs from a company with high quality standards for growing, extraction, processing and lab testing. It's also important for dog owners to consult with their veterinarian before starting CBD, particularly if their dog is taking prescription medications.
